本発明は連結具、壁掛け具、および連結部の構造に関するものである。   The present invention relates to a structure of a connecting tool, a wall hanging tool, and a connecting portion.

連結、連結解除を可能にするもので、手軽なものとして、従来、例えば特許文献1に記載される面ファスナがある。面ファスナは、具体的には例えば、表面にフック状の起毛があるフック側と、ループ状の起毛があるループ側との一対で構成され、両者を指先で押し付けることによりフックがループに係止して連結される。連結時にはフックとループの多数が係止しているために、連結強度が良好になる。連結解除は、ループとの係止が解除されるまでフックを弾性変形させればよい。但し、多数のフックの全てを同時に弾性変形させるには多大な力を要することから、具体的には、フック側とループ側の双方の面ファスナを指先で離隔方向に捲り返すように引っ張るなどすることにより、捲り返しの基端部分にある適数のフックのみを順次弾性変形させ、引き剥がすようにしてなされる。   Conventionally, there is a hook-and-loop fastener described in Patent Document 1, for example, which enables connection and disconnection. Specifically, for example, the hook-and-loop fastener is composed of a pair of a hook side having a hook-like raised surface and a loop side having a loop-like raised surface, and the hook is locked to the loop by pressing both with a fingertip. Connected. Since many hooks and loops are locked at the time of connection, the connection strength is improved. The connection may be released by elastically deforming the hook until the engagement with the loop is released. However, since it takes a great deal of force to simultaneously elastically deform all of the many hooks, specifically, the hook and loop side fasteners are pulled back in the separation direction with the fingertips. As a result, only an appropriate number of hooks at the base end portion of the turn are sequentially elastically deformed and peeled off.

特開2012-120684号公報JP 2012-120684 A

しかしながら、上述のように面ファスナは連結解除の際に指先で捲り返すように引っ張る操作をするために、例えば、このような操作をするのに十分なスペースが確保できないような場合には採用するのが困難になってしまうなど、使い勝手が悪いという欠点がある。   However, as described above, the hook-and-loop fastener performs an operation of pulling back with the fingertip when releasing the connection. For example, it is employed when a sufficient space for such an operation cannot be secured. There is a drawback that it is difficult to use.

本発明は以上の欠点を解消すべくなされたものであって、手軽で、使い勝手の良い連結具の提供を目的とする。また、本発明の他の目的は、手軽で、使い勝手のよい壁掛け具、連結部の構造の提供にある。   The present invention has been made to solve the above-described drawbacks, and an object of the present invention is to provide a simple and easy-to-use connector. Another object of the present invention is to provide a wall hanging tool that is easy and convenient to use and a structure of a connecting portion.

本発明によれば、連結具は、一対の面ファスナ3、4を利用して構成され、これらを押し付けることにより手軽に連結可能に形成される。一対の面ファスナ3、4の一方4が取り付けられる連結対象物2には摺動部材5が取り付けられ、この摺動部材5には面ファスナ支持面6が形成されており、面ファスナ4は面ファスナ支持面6上に支持されることで上述のように押し付けたときに他方の面ファスナ3と連結することができる。   According to the present invention, the connector is configured using the pair of surface fasteners 3 and 4 and is formed so as to be easily connectable by pressing them. A sliding member 5 is attached to the connection object 2 to which one of the pair of surface fasteners 3 and 4 is attached, and a surface fastener supporting surface 6 is formed on the sliding member 5, and the surface fastener 4 is a surface fastener. By being supported on the fastener support surface 6, it can be connected to the other surface fastener 3 when pressed as described above.

また、上述した面ファスナ3、4の一方4は、一端部4aが面ファスナ支持面6よりも連結対象物2寄りの位置で摺動部材5に連結されて他方の面ファスナ3と連結不能にされるとともに、他端側が面ファスナ支持面6上に摺動自在に支持されて摺動部材5と相対移動可能にされる。このため、他方の面ファスナ3に押し付けたときには、一端部4aが摺動部材5のみに、他端側が他方の面ファスナ3のみに連結されることから、摺動部材5を一端部4a側から他端側にスライド移動させれば、他端側が他方の面ファスナ3との連結解除を伴って撓む。面ファスナ3、4同士の連結解除は、スライド移動量の増大に伴って漸次進行するために、撓み変形の基端部分にある適数のフック等のみを順次弾性変形させれば足りることから、摺動部材5のスライド移動操作に多大な力を要することはない。   In addition, one of the above-described surface fasteners 3 and 4 is connected to the sliding member 5 at one end 4a closer to the connection object 2 than the surface fastener support surface 6 and cannot be connected to the other surface fastener 3. At the same time, the other end side is slidably supported on the surface fastener supporting surface 6 so as to be movable relative to the sliding member 5. For this reason, when pressed against the other surface fastener 3, the one end portion 4a is connected only to the sliding member 5, and the other end side is connected only to the other surface fastener 3, so that the sliding member 5 is connected from the one end portion 4a side. If it is slid to the other end side, the other end side bends with the release of the connection with the other surface fastener 3. Since the release of the connection between the surface fasteners 3 and 4 gradually proceeds with an increase in the amount of slide movement, it is sufficient to sequentially elastically deform only an appropriate number of hooks or the like at the base end portion of the bending deformation. A large force is not required for the sliding movement operation of the sliding member 5.

したがって本発明によれば、面ファスナ3、4同士を捲り返すように引っ張ったときとほぼ同様の連結解除の挙動、振る舞いを摺動部材5のスライド移動によって実現することができ、あまり場所を取らないスライド移動操作のスペースさえあれば使用できるために、使い勝手を極めて高めることができる。また連結解除操作を実質的に、特定の方向へのスライド移動操作のみに限ることが可能になることから、妄りな連結解除のおそれを解消することも可能になる。   Therefore, according to the present invention, it is possible to realize the disconnection behavior and behavior that are almost the same as when the surface fasteners 3 and 4 are pulled back and forth by sliding the sliding member 5, and take up too much space. Since it can be used as long as there is no space for slide movement operation, the usability can be greatly enhanced. In addition, since it is possible to substantially limit the connection release operation to only the slide movement operation in a specific direction, it is possible to eliminate the possibility of annoying connection release.

さらに、連結解除がスライド移動操作によって実現されることから、面ファスナ3、4同士を捲り返すように引っ張る場合のように、面ファスナ3(4)が取り付けられる部分に柔軟性を要さない。この性格を利用し、面ファスナ3、4の一方3を硬質の被連結部1に固定可能に形成した上で、面ファスナ支持面6を硬質材料により形成した場合には、連結状態での面ファスナ3、4の妄りな撓み変形が規制され、連結状態の安定性が極めて向上する。   Further, since the connection release is realized by the slide movement operation, the portion to which the surface fastener 3 (4) is attached does not need flexibility as in the case where the surface fasteners 3 and 4 are pulled back and forth. When this surface is used and one of the surface fasteners 3 and 4 is formed so as to be fixed to the hard connected portion 1 and the surface fastener supporting surface 6 is formed of a hard material, the surface in the connected state is obtained. Delicate bending deformation of the fasteners 3 and 4 is restricted, and the stability of the connected state is greatly improved.

また、上述のように摺動部材5のスライド移動操作に伴って面ファスナ4の他端側を撓ませる場合において、摺動部材5にスライド移動に伴って生じる他の面ファスナ4の撓み変形部位を収容する収容部7を形成した場合には、撓み変形がスムーズになるためにスライド移動時の操作力を良好に低減して操作性を高めることができる。   Further, when the other end side of the surface fastener 4 is bent in accordance with the slide movement operation of the sliding member 5 as described above, the bending deformation portion of the other surface fastener 4 that is generated by the sliding movement of the sliding member 5. In the case where the accommodating portion 7 that accommodates is formed, the bending deformation becomes smooth, so that the operation force during the sliding movement can be favorably reduced and the operability can be enhanced.

さらに、上述のように面ファスナ4の他端側を面ファスナ支持面6により摺動自在に支持する場合において、当該他端側を摺動部材5に連結解除容易に連結して未装着時に面ファスナ3と装着可能な姿勢に保持するとともに、摺動部材5のスライド移動により連結解除される姿勢保持部8を設けた場合には、他端側の不要な撓みが規制されるために連結操作がしやすくなる。姿勢保持部8は、摺動部材5に面ファスナ4の他端側に係止する係止部を設けて構成したり、あるいは、他端側と面ファスナ支持面6の双方に鉄板とマグネットシートを取り付けたり、さらには、これらのいずれかに低粘着性の粘着層を設けて構成することが可能である。   Further, when the other end side of the surface fastener 4 is slidably supported by the surface fastener support surface 6 as described above, the other end side is easily connected to the sliding member 5 to release the surface. When the posture holding portion 8 that is held in a posture capable of being attached to the fastener 3 and is released from the connection by the sliding movement of the sliding member 5 is provided, the unnecessary bending on the other end side is restricted, so that the connecting operation is performed. It becomes easy to do. The posture holding portion 8 is configured by providing the sliding member 5 with a locking portion for locking to the other end side of the surface fastener 4, or an iron plate and a magnet sheet on both the other end side and the surface fastener supporting surface 6. It is possible to attach a low pressure-sensitive adhesive layer to any one of these.

図1ないし図3に本発明の第1の実施の形態を示す。この実施の形態は、絵画20を収容した額縁2(連結対象物2)を壁面1(被連結部1)に取り付けるに際して本発明に係る連結具Aを用いるものである。図1(a)および(b)に示すように、額縁2の背面の上部両側縁部にはフック側の面ファスナ(他の面ファスナ4)が取付られ、壁面1の対応位置にはループ側の面ファスナ(面ファスナ3)が固定される。   1 to 3 show a first embodiment of the present invention. In this embodiment, the connecting tool A according to the present invention is used when attaching the frame 2 (connection object 2) containing the painting 20 to the wall surface 1 (connected portion 1). As shown in FIGS. 1 (a) and 1 (b), hook-side surface fasteners (other surface fasteners 4) are attached to both upper side edge portions of the back surface of the frame 2, and the corresponding positions of the wall surface 1 are on the loop side. The surface fastener (surface fastener 3) is fixed.

連結具Aは、図2に示すように、上述したフック側の面ファスナ4を摺動部材5に連結して形成されるオス側部材21と、上述のループ側の面ファスナ3からなるメス側部材22とを有する。双方の面ファスナ3、4はほぼ同じ幅寸法の短冊近似形状に形成され、その長さはフック側の面ファスナ4が少しだけより長寸にされる。   As shown in FIG. 2, the connector A includes a male side member 21 formed by connecting the hook-side hook-and-loop fastener 4 to the sliding member 5 and a loop-side hook-and-loop fastener 3 described above. Member 22. Both hook-and-loop fasteners 3 and 4 are formed in a strip-like shape having substantially the same width, and the length of the hook-and-loop hook-and-loop fastener 4 is slightly longer.

上記摺動部材5は、硬質材料により形成され、具体的にはこの実施の形態においてはステンレスの板材を折曲等して形成される。この摺動部材5は、フック側の面ファスナ4の一端部4aと連結される面ファスナ連結部23と、フック側の面ファスナ4の他端側をループ側の面ファスナ3と連結可能に支持する面ファスナ支持部24と、額縁2に取り付けられる取付部25とを有する。上記面ファスナ支持部24は、面ファスナ3(4)と同じ程度の幅寸法の平板状に形成され、表面にフック側の面ファスナ4を支持する面ファスナ支持面6を備える。   The sliding member 5 is made of a hard material. Specifically, in this embodiment, the sliding member 5 is formed by bending a stainless steel plate. The sliding member 5 supports a surface fastener connecting portion 23 connected to one end portion 4a of the hook-side surface fastener 4 and the other end side of the hook-side surface fastener 4 to be connectable to the loop-side surface fastener 3. A hook-and-loop fastener support portion 24 and a mounting portion 25 attached to the frame 2. The surface fastener support portion 24 is formed in a flat plate shape having the same width as the surface fastener 3 (4), and includes a surface fastener support surface 6 that supports the surface fastener 4 on the hook side on the surface.

上記面ファスナ連結部23は、面ファスナ支持部24の一端縁から裏面側に向かって傾斜状に延設されて先端部にバーリング加工によりネジ穴が開設された傾斜板材26と、この傾斜板材26の先端部の裏面に重ねられ、上記ネジ穴に対応する位置にネジ挿入孔が開設された押さえ板材27とを有する。押さえ板材27の傾斜部材26側の外表面にはローレット加工が施されて摩擦抵抗が高められ、フック側の面ファスナ4は、傾斜板材26にネジ止めされる押さえ板材27と傾斜板材26との間で一端部4aを挟持され、また、ネジ28により抜け止めされる。   The hook-and-loop fastener connecting portion 23 extends in an inclined manner from one end edge of the hook-and-loop fastener support portion 24 toward the back surface, and has a screw hole formed in the tip portion by burring, and the inclined plate material 26. And a pressing plate member 27 having a screw insertion hole formed at a position corresponding to the screw hole. The outer surface of the holding plate member 27 on the inclined member 26 side is knurled to increase the frictional resistance, and the hook-side surface fastener 4 is formed between the holding plate member 27 and the inclined plate member 26 screwed to the inclined plate member 26. The one end 4a is sandwiched between them, and is prevented from coming off by a screw 28.

上記取付部25は、摺動部材5の両端部に配置される。図2(a)および(b)において上方に配置される取付部25は、面ファスナ支持部24の面ファスナ連結部23とは反対の辺縁から裏面側に延設される中継壁29と、この中継壁29の先端から面ファスナ3支持部と平行な方向に延設される取付壁30とを有して側面視L字状に形成され、取付壁30には額縁2にネジ止め可能なネジ挿通孔30aが穿孔される。また、下方に配置される取付部25は、面ファスナ連結部23の面ファスナ支持部24とは反対の辺縁から面ファスナ3支持部と平行方向に延設され、同様にネジ挿通孔30aが穿孔される平板状からなる。   The mounting portion 25 is disposed at both ends of the sliding member 5. 2 (a) and 2 (b), the mounting portion 25 disposed above the relay wall 29 extending from the edge opposite to the surface fastener connecting portion 23 of the surface fastener supporting portion 24 to the back surface side, The relay wall 29 has an attachment wall 30 extending from the front end of the relay wall 29 in a direction parallel to the surface fastener 3 support portion. The attachment wall 30 can be screwed to the frame 2 on the attachment wall 30. A screw insertion hole 30a is drilled. The mounting portion 25 disposed below extends from the edge of the surface fastener connecting portion 23 opposite to the surface fastener support portion 24 in a direction parallel to the surface fastener 3 support portion, and similarly has a screw insertion hole 30a. It consists of a flat plate to be perforated.

したがってオス側部材21は、摺動部材5の取付部25を額縁2の背面にネジ28でネジ止めすることにより額縁2に固定される。固定状態において、フック側の面ファスナ4は、面ファスナ連結部23に連結される一端部4aを中心にして捲り返し可能に他端側を背面から面ファスナ支持部24により支持される。ループ側の面ファスナ3が固定された壁面1に向かって額縁2が押し込まれると、面ファスナ支持面6により支持されたフック側の面ファスナ4の他端側は表面をループ側の面ファスナ3に押し付けられて該ループ側の面ファスナ3と連結される。このとき、摺動部材5に連結される一端部4aは、表面を押さえ板材27により覆われ、また、面ファスナ支持部24よりも背面側に位置することから、ループ側の面ファスナ3とは非連結状態に保持される。   Therefore, the male side member 21 is fixed to the frame 2 by screwing the attachment portion 25 of the sliding member 5 to the back surface of the frame 2 with the screw 28. In the fixed state, the hook-side hook and loop fastener 4 is supported by the hook-and-loop fastener support portion 24 from the back side so that it can be turned around the one end portion 4a connected to the hook-and-loop fastener connecting portion 23. When the frame 2 is pushed toward the wall surface 1 to which the loop-side surface fastener 3 is fixed, the other end side of the hook-side surface fastener 4 supported by the surface fastener support surface 6 becomes the surface of the loop-side surface fastener 3. And is connected to the surface fastener 3 on the loop side. At this time, the one end portion 4a connected to the sliding member 5 is covered with the pressing plate material 27 and is located on the back side with respect to the surface fastener support portion 24. Held in an unconnected state.

さらに、以上の連結具Aには、上述したように額縁2を壁面1に固定する際に、捲り返し可能に支持されるフック側の面ファスナ4の他端側が振動等で捲り返されてループ側の面ファスナ3と連結できなくなってしまうのを防ぐために、姿勢保持部8が形成される。この姿勢保持部8は、摺動部材5に形成されてフック側の面ファスナ4の他端縁部に係止する係止片31を有し、該係止片31は具体的には、面ファスナ支持部24の面ファスナ連結部23とは反対側に位置する取付壁30の先端から面ファスナ支持部24に向かって立ち上がる立ち上がり壁32の先端に形成される。この係止片31の先端は面ファスナ支持部24よりも背面側に位置し、フック側の面ファスナ4の他端縁部を背面側に撓ませることで係止する。   Furthermore, when the frame 2 is fixed to the wall surface 1 as described above, the other end side of the hook-side hook and loop fastener 4 supported so as to be turned back is turned over by vibration or the like in the above-described connector A. In order to prevent the connection with the side surface fastener 3, the posture holding portion 8 is formed. The posture holding portion 8 includes a locking piece 31 formed on the sliding member 5 and locked to the other end edge of the hook-side surface fastener 4. Specifically, the locking piece 31 is a surface. The fastener support 24 is formed at the tip of a rising wall 32 that rises from the tip of the mounting wall 30 located on the opposite side of the fastener fastening portion 23 to the hook-and-loop fastener support 24. The front end of the locking piece 31 is positioned on the back side with respect to the hook and loop fastener support portion 24 and is locked by bending the other end edge of the hook side hook and loop fastener 4 to the back side.

また、以上の係止片31を係止させるために、フック側の面ファスナ4の他端縁部には、係止片31の断面とほぼ同じ程度の開口面積を備えた開口部33が開設される。この開口部33は開放部33aを介してフック側の面ファスナ4の他端縁に開放しており、この開放部33a、および上述したように係止片31の高さが面ファスナ支持面6よりも低いことにより、フック側の面ファスナ4は係止片31との係止解除がしやすくされる。   In addition, in order to lock the locking piece 31 described above, an opening 33 having an opening area substantially the same as the cross section of the locking piece 31 is formed at the other end edge of the hook-side surface fastener 4. Is done. The opening 33 opens to the other end edge of the hook-side surface fastener 4 via the opening 33a. The height of the opening 33a and the locking piece 31 is the surface fastener support surface 6 as described above. The hook-side surface fastener 4 can be easily released from the engagement with the engagement piece 31.

一方、上述した壁面1が石膏ボードにより形成されるこの実施の形態において、メス側部材22、すなわちループ側の面ファスナ3は、壁面1にステープル9により止着される。このステープル9は、具体的には、文房具として広く利用される10号のサイズのものであり、したがって打ち込み作業が手軽で、また、一般的な画鋲よりも線形が細いためにループ側の面ファスナ3を取り外した後でも打ち込み跡があまり目立たない。なお、ループ側の面ファスナ3は、後述する第2の実施の形態におけるように、壁面1に対して粘着テープ42により固定することも可能である。   On the other hand, in this embodiment in which the wall surface 1 described above is formed of gypsum board, the female member 22, that is, the loop-side surface fastener 3 is fixed to the wall surface 1 with staples 9. Specifically, the staple 9 has a size of 10 which is widely used as a stationery, and therefore is easy to drive and is thinner than a general thumbtack. Even after 3 is removed, the traces of driving are not so noticeable. The loop-side surface fastener 3 can be fixed to the wall surface 1 with an adhesive tape 42 as in a second embodiment to be described later.

また、上記ステープル9の打ち込みによってループ側の面ファスナ3を壁面1に良好に固定するために、連結具Aは治具50を備える。この治具50は、ループ側の面ファスナ3とほぼ同じサイズの薄板状をなし、図2(c)に示すように、テープル9の頭部よりもひとまわり大きい広さの透孔からなる窓部50aの複数を備える。具体的には治具50は紙により構成することが可能である。また、上記窓部50aは治具50の表面全面に均等に所定ピッチでマトリクス状に配置される。   Further, in order to fix the loop-side surface fastener 3 to the wall surface 1 satisfactorily by driving the staple 9, the connector A includes a jig 50. The jig 50 has a thin plate shape substantially the same size as the surface fastener 3 on the loop side, and as shown in FIG. 2 (c), a window made of a through-hole having a size larger than the head of the table 9. A plurality of parts 50a are provided. Specifically, the jig 50 can be made of paper. The window portions 50a are arranged in a matrix at a predetermined pitch evenly on the entire surface of the jig 50.

したがって壁面1に額縁2を固定するに際しては、先ず、壁面1における額縁2を固定したい位置にループ側の面ファスナ3を適宜位置合わせしたら、その表面に治具50を重ねて表面側から手で押さえつけるなどした上で、ステープラを用いて窓部50aを通してステープル9を打ち込む。この際、窓部50aを目安にすることにより、図3(c)に示すように、適数のステープル9によってループ側の面ファスナ3を容易に、全体的にバランス良くしっかりと壁面1に固定することができる。なお、ループ側の面ファスナ3は、一般に、フック側の面ファスナ4に比べて起毛が長く、より柔らかいために、ステープル9はこの後なされるフック側の面ファスナ4との連結をあまり邪魔することなく、かつ、深くしっかりと壁面1に打ち込まれる。ループ側の面ファスナ3を壁面1に固定したら治具50を取り外しておき、また、以上のループ側の面ファスナ3の壁面1への固定と並行して、上述したように額縁2にオス側部材21を取り付ける。   Therefore, when the frame 2 is fixed to the wall surface 1, first, the loop-side surface fastener 3 is appropriately positioned at the position where the frame 2 is to be fixed on the wall surface 1, and then the jig 50 is overlapped on the surface and the hand is manually applied from the surface side. After pressing, the staple 9 is driven through the window 50a using a stapler. At this time, by using the window 50a as a guide, as shown in FIG. 3C, the surface fastener 3 on the loop side is easily fixed to the wall surface 1 with a proper number of staples 9 in a well-balanced manner as a whole. can do. Since the loop-side hook and loop fastener 3 is generally longer and softer than the hook-side hook and loop fastener 4, the staple 9 does not interfere with the subsequent hook-side hook and loop fastener 4. Without being driven into the wall 1 deeply and firmly. Once the loop-side surface fastener 3 is fixed to the wall surface 1, the jig 50 is removed, and in parallel with the fixing of the loop-side surface fastener 3 to the wall surface 1, as described above, the frame 2 is connected to the male side. The member 21 is attached.

以上の準備が整ったら、係止片31を開口部33に係止させ、フック側の面ファスナ4の他端側を額縁2の背面とほぼ並行な姿勢にした後、ループ側の面ファスナ3に押し付けるようにして額縁2を壁面1に向かって押し込む。これにより、双方の面ファスナ3、4が連結され、額縁2が壁面1に固定される。図3(a)はこの固定状態を示すもので、上述したようにフック側の面ファスナ4は他端側のみにおいてループ側の面ファスナ3と連結される。   When the above preparation is completed, the locking piece 31 is locked to the opening 33, and the other end side of the hook-side surface fastener 4 is brought into a posture substantially parallel to the back surface of the frame 2, and then the loop-side surface fastener 3 is set. The frame 2 is pushed toward the wall 1 so as to be pressed against the wall 1. Thereby, both surface fasteners 3 and 4 are connected, and the frame 2 is fixed to the wall surface 1. FIG. 3A shows this fixed state. As described above, the hook-side surface fastener 4 is connected to the loop-side surface fastener 3 only at the other end side.

また、連結具Aが額縁2の上部のみに配置されるこの実施の形態において、図1(b)に示すように、額縁2の下部には支持体34が取り付けられる。この支持体34は、ブロック状の本体部34aの背面に滑り止め34bを取り付けて形成され、連結具Aから離れた位置にある額縁2の下部が壁面1に近接する方向に傾いてしまうのを防ぐ。上記本体部34aはオス側部材21と同じ程度の幅寸法に形成され、図示しない接着剤等により額縁2の背面に固定される。   In this embodiment in which the connector A is disposed only at the upper part of the frame 2, a support 34 is attached to the lower part of the frame 2 as shown in FIG. The support 34 is formed by attaching a non-slip 34b to the back surface of the block-shaped main body 34a, and the lower portion of the frame 2 at a position away from the connector A is inclined in a direction approaching the wall surface 1. prevent. The main body 34a is formed to have the same width as the male member 21, and is fixed to the back surface of the frame 2 with an adhesive (not shown).

さらに、上述のようにして壁面1に取り付けた額縁2の姿勢が水平に対してやや傾いてしまっていたら、取り外して姿勢を正して再度取り付け直せばよい。取り外しの際には、上方に向かって額縁2をスライド移動させれば良く、このときフック側の面ファスナ4は、一端部4aが額縁2とともに上方に移動するが、壁面1に固定されたループ側の面ファスナ3と連結状態にある他端側は原位置に止まろうとする。このため、図3(b)に示すように、他端側は面ファスナ支持面6を摺動するようにして下方に向かって摺動部材5に対して相対移動し、これにより開口部33は係止片31と係止解除され、また、相対移動した長さの分だけ面ファスナ連結部23とループ側の面ファスナ3との隙間(収容部7)において下方に向かって凸に撓む。相対移動量が大きくなるにつれて撓み部位は面ファスナ連結部23に引っ張られるようにして漸次上方に移動し、撓みの基端部分において他端側がループ側の面ファスナ3から漸次剥がされる。   Furthermore, if the posture of the frame 2 attached to the wall surface 1 as described above is slightly inclined with respect to the horizontal, it may be removed, corrected in posture, and reattached. At the time of removal, the frame 2 may be slid upward. At this time, the hook-side surface fastener 4 has one end 4a moved upward together with the frame 2, but the loop fixed to the wall 1 The other end side connected to the side surface fastener 3 tries to stop at the original position. For this reason, as shown in FIG. 3B, the other end side slides relative to the sliding member 5 in a downward direction so as to slide on the surface fastener supporting surface 6, whereby the opening 33 is formed. The latch is released from the latching piece 31 and bends downward in the gap (accommodating portion 7) between the hook-and-loop fastener connecting portion 23 and the loop-side hook-and-loop fastener 3 by the length of the relative movement. As the amount of relative movement increases, the bent portion gradually moves upward so as to be pulled by the hook-and-loop fastener connecting portion 23, and the other end side is gradually peeled off from the loop-side hook-and-loop fastener 3 at the base end portion of the bend.

なお、額縁2を取り外す際のスライド移動操作方向Fは、図3(b)に示すように、額縁2の荷重方向Wと反対にされるために、スライド移動操作がなされないときに額縁2が妄りに壁面1から外れてしまうことはない。   As shown in FIG. 3B, the slide movement operation direction F when removing the frame 2 is opposite to the load direction W of the frame 2, so that the frame 2 is moved when the slide movement operation is not performed. There is no detachment from the wall 1.
